The classic truck market is one that that has been rapidly growing and one of the most iconic trucks benefitting from this market growth is the Chevrolet C10.
Most of these trucks were used as work horses and were not well preserved and that is why it is so special when you find one of these trucks in excellent condition. This 1965 Chevrolet
C10 is one of these great trucks that has under gone an excellent and extensive restoration. The restoration on this truck was done in factory style. So, it is powered by a 250 cubic inch 6-cylinder and backed by a 3-speed manual transmission with a column shift.
This 6-cylinder is extremely tight and runs excellent. The 3-speed manual transmissions operates just as it should and shifts excellent. This truck delivers an awesome sound going down the road thanks to a split, long tube header and true dual exhaust. The blue metallic exterior is in excellent condition with very few defects. Both the cab and bed of this awesome pickup are rust free and extremely straight. The exterior of this
C10 is complimented nicely by the factory style chrome hubcaps, wide-whitewall tires, factory stainless trim, chrome mirrors, and wood bed. The matching blue interior is in excellent shape as well with few to no defects.
This fantastic example of a 1965 Chevrolet C10 is well equipped with options such as: power steering, AM/FM/Bluetooth stereo, variable speed wipers, and heater/defroster.
